Output 51453c73d185981675c9c84fdcc26ff6f792e9b018d3da49e4fba7a08c4cc213:0

value
89014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5421e32b10eb48aa62c722e951dbdc8563453eef OP_EQUAL
address
MFa1b5bhfiTQfLBpW3gkrZqdm24d6CNtb4
transaction
51453c73d185981675c9c84fdcc26ff6f792e9b018d3da49e4fba7a08c4cc213
spent
true